Your server is fine. The route into China is not. Pathfabric puts one dedicated premium Los Angeles IPv4 /32 on the machine you already run, and traffic to your Chinese users rides premium carrier routes instead of the congested default path.
Ordinary international transit into China is oversubscribed. At peak hours it drops packets and latency balloons, so a server that feels instant from Berlin or Dallas feels broken from Shanghai. Moving the server to Asia is expensive and drags your data with it. A CDN only helps cacheable HTTP. Most operators just live with it.

The Los Angeles hub connects to all three major Chinese carriers over their premium international networks, plus local peering and direct links to major platforms.
China Telecom’s premium Global Internet Access network, the well-known gold standard for CT-connected users.
China Mobile International’s premium backbone, covering the carrier with the largest mobile user base.
China Unicom’s premium international routes for CU-connected users and offices.
Real-world performance inside China varies by region, carrier, and time of day. A premium path improves the odds dramatically; it does not repeal physics. Details on the network page.
